About the Hand Therapy format

Hand Therapy is a peer-reviewed journal published by SAGE, covering Orthopedic Surgery and Rehabilitation, Musculoskeletal pain and rehabilitation, Peripheral Nerve Disorders.

PublisherSAGE
Reference styleAuthor–year (Harvard)
Author–year — (Smith, 2023) in the text
Smith, A., Jones, B. and Lee, C. (2023) 'A representative article title', Hand Therapy, 12(3), pp. 45–58.

The Manchester short splint: A change to splinting practice in the rehabilitation of zone II flexor tendon repairs

FH Peck, AE Roe, Chye Yew Ng et al. · 27 May 2014

Introduction The results of patients with primary zone II flexor tendon repairs rehabilitated using a traditional forearm-based splint were audited and compared with those who were managed in the Manchester short splint. Method The short splint was fabricated to permit maximal wrist flexion and up to 45° of wrist extension with a block to 30°…

Grip and pinch strength: Normative data for healthy Indian adults

Rajani Mullerpatan, Gayatri Karnik, Rebecca John · 1 Mar 2013

Introduction Normative values of grip and pinch strength are used to determine the effect of treatment, to assess patients’ initial limitation and provide a baseline for re-assessment of patient progress. Data gathered from western populations cannot be used for reference in Indian populations due to variations in genetic, environmental and nutritional factors. Methods A convenience…
